Each milestone gets you a Visual Studio solution that is similar to the original solution, except that the Silverlight tools have been replaced with the OpenSilver tools. No effort is required on your side: we take care of all the work. Instead of changing your application code, we work on improving OpenSilver to make it behaves exactly like Silverlight. ![]() Our team of experts at Userware - the company behind OpenSilver - offers fixed-cost, milestone-based, end-to-end professional services to transition your application from Silverlight to OpenSilver. More importantly, the resulting application runs on all browsers and is almost pixel-perfect identical to the original one. The back-end code is untouched, and you can keep maintaining and improving your application like you did before, or modernize it at your own pace by leveraging the latest technologies. When moving from Silverlight to OpenSilver, your application code is not modified. You are in the right place! OpenSilver is a modern open-source replacement for Microsoft Silverlight that revives the technology and brings it to the next level.
